Abstract

Carbon disulfide is made by contacting hydrocarbons with sulfur vapor and sulfur dioxide at temperatures between 500.degree. - 1000.degree.C. for 0.3 - 10 seconds in the absence of a catalyst. The total sulfur introduced as sulfur vapor and sulfur dioxide is between 2.1 and 3.5 atoms per hydrocarbon carbon atom.
